摘要:
最近有并行开发Android与iOS端App,想在这总结一些两种开发的相似与区别。 阅读全文
摘要:
首先OpenGL2框架的使用需要 #import OpenGL 调用的是GPU,而不是CPU所以,在不断改变属性的时候不会出现卡顿。大概的调用方法分为 :// 1.首先GLK 需要一个渲染环境 , 先创建一个EAGLContext渲染环境, GLKView 初始化的时候需要使用// 2.初始化 ... 阅读全文
摘要:
-(NSArray*)tableView:(UITableView *)tableView editActionsForRowAtIndexPath:(NSIndexPath *)indexPath{ UITableViewRowAction *rowAction = [UITableView... 阅读全文
摘要:
GitHub地址https://github.com/JerryWanXuJie/XJAlbum图片浏览器主要通过 UIScrollView 实现 在一个大的ScollView里面套 n个ScollViewUIScrollView里主要是有两个属性,contentSize和contentoffset... 阅读全文
摘要:
网上找到的常用正则表达式,留着以后可能用得上,正则表达式实在是不好写,只好拿来主义了,在Delphi中没有自己带有正则表达式的组件,靠第三方了,都说PerlRegEx 是首选, 去这里下载,官方网站:http://www.regular-expressions.info/delphi.html。另外... 阅读全文
摘要:
ios 里的 三级控制器 是 一个 tabbar控制器 控制 多个 navigation 控制器, 然后每个 navigation 控制器 对应着 一个 view本项目 初始化分为两部分 : 视图初始化 , tabbar 初始化//视图初始化-(void)initView{ //set vie... 阅读全文
摘要:
本项目主要是 使用 tableview 控件,使用 plist里所定义的 dictionary 格式文件 显示// 通过 nsbundle 将 heros.plist 文件 取出到 一个 数组 array 里 NSString *file=[[NSBundle mainBundle] pathF... 阅读全文
摘要:
汤姆猫游戏主要是使用动画来完成。-(void)makeanimate :(NSString *)name forint:(NSInteger)count{ if(![self.imageview isAnimating]) { //要创建一个动画: 1.创建一个数组 2.... 阅读全文
摘要:
NSArray *myPaths=NSSearchPathForDirectoriesInDomains(NSDocumentDirectory, NSUserDomainMask, YES);//NSDocumentDirectory 是表示沙盒里 document 文件夹的列表//NSDocu... 阅读全文
摘要:
这是一个重写 cell 的方法 ,reuseIdentifier 是 在可是界面里 tableview 的 id UITableViewCell *cell = [tableView dequeueReusableCellWithIdentifier:@"reuseIdentifier" f... 阅读全文